Sr. Programmer Analyst Salary Range: $100k to $150k Overview
A leading organization is seeking a Sr. Programmer Analyst to support and optimize enterprise digital analytics and data collection initiatives. This role will focus on implementing scalable tagging solutions, managing analytics infrastructure, ensuring data integrity, and supporting cross-functional digital experience initiatives.

The ideal candidate will bring strong experience with enterprise tag management platforms, analytics ecosystems, and front-end technologies, along with expertise in governance, privacy compliance, and event-driven data architectures.
Key Responsibilities Tag Management & Analytics Implementation
  • Develop, implement, and maintain tagging solutions across digital platforms using enterprise tag management systems including:
    • Adobe Experience Platform (AEP) Data Collection / Adobe Launch
    • Google Tag Manager (GTM)
    • Tealium
    • Other enterprise tagging platforms
  • Configure and manage tag properties, rules, and workflows across multiple domains and environments
  • Support publishing processes and library management within AEP Data Collection
  • Design and execute scalable analytics tracking strategies and tagging standards
Data Collection & Analytics Architecture
  • Implement and maintain event-driven analytics frameworks including:
    • EDDL
    • AdobeDataLayer
  • Ensure accurate, consistent, and efficient data collection across digital properties
  • Partner with stakeholders to define tracking requirements and data layer specifications
  • Support enterprise customer journey and digital analytics initiatives
Testing, Debugging & Data Quality
  • Conduct validation, QA testing, and debugging of analytics implementations
  • Troubleshoot tagging and tracking issues to ensure data integrity and platform performance
  • Monitor analytics accuracy and tracking consistency across web environments
Cross-Functional Collaboration
  • Collaborate with:
    • Front-end engineering teams
    • UX/UI teams
    • Product managers and product owners
    • Business analysts
    • Marketing and analytics stakeholders
  • Align analytics implementation strategies with business and customer experience objectives
  • Provide support and guidance for analytics best practices and governance standards
Governance, Compliance & Documentation
  • Enforce tagging governance standards and implementation best practices
  • Ensure compliance with data privacy regulations including GDPR and CCPA
  • Create and maintain implementation documentation and tracking specifications
  • Support onboarding and training efforts related to analytics tools and processes
Required Qualifications
  • 5+ years of experience in digital analytics, tag management, or analytics implementation
  • Hands-on experience with:
    • Adobe Experience Platform (AEP) Data Collection / Adobe Launch
    • Google Tag Manager (GTM)
    • Tealium
    • Similar enterprise tag management platforms
  • Strong experience with:
    • Tag implementation
    • Testing and debugging
    • Analytics solution design and planning
  • Strong JavaScript skills related to analytics and tag deployment
  • Working knowledge of:
    • HTML
    • CSS
    • Front-end development concepts
  • Experience with data layer standards, governance, and formatting
  • Familiarity with Agile development methodologies and software development lifecycle processes
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, or related STEM field
